Photo Of Security Guard Who Was Nabbed While About To Sell The Car Left In His Custody In Niger
![](https://spazr.com.ng/wp-content/uploads/2024/07/Photo-Of-Security-Guard-Who-Was-Nabbed-While-About-To.jpg)
A security man, Henry Musa, has been arrested by the Police in Niger State.
The man was nabbed for allegedly stealing a vehicle entrusted in his custody in Anambra State at Sabon-Wuse in Niger State.
The command in a statement signed by the Police Public Relations Officer (PRO) SP Wasiu Abiodun in Minna said the suspect was picked based on reliable information received by the police attached to the Sabon-Wuse in Tafa local government Division.
He explained that Musa was arrested on Tuesday 2nd July,2024 with a Toyota Camry vehicle bearing Reg. No. LND 851 CJ, is suspected to have been stolen from Anambra State.
The PRO stated that the suspect was seen at Dikko, along the Abuja-Kaduna Expressway in the Tafa area of Niger State with duplicate copies of the document to sell the vehicle.
According to him ”The Police operatives of the Division were quickly mobilised to the area and the suspect was taken into custody with the vehicle”
”During interrogation, he confessed that he was a security man in a hotel at Awka and that the key of the vehicle was entrusted to him by the owner But he decided to take the vehicle away, and was going to Dikko to dispose of it”.
He added that the suspect is under investigation and will be transferred to SCID for further investigation and prosecution immediately after the investigations.

Reps Committee Summons Women Affairs Minister Over Alleged Diversion Of Funds
![](https://spazr.com.ng/wp-content/uploads/2024/07/Reps-Committee-Summons-Women-Affairs-Minister-Over-Alleged-Diversion-Of.jpg)
Uju Kennedy-Ohaneye
The Minister of Women Affairs, Uju Kennedy-Ohaneye, has been summoned by the House of Representatives Committee on Women Affairs Social Development, to appear before the panel on Tuesday, July 9, to give a detailed breakdown on the alleged diversion of about N1.5 billion meant for payment of contractors.
The chairman of the committee, Hon. Kafilat Ogbara (APC, Lagos) gave the directive at an interactive session with officials of the ministry.
Ogbara said the minister is expected to come with relevant documents to defend the whereabouts of the money.
The interactive session followed a petition by contractors of the ministry to the House over non-payment for contracts executed running into billions of Naira.
The committee also ordered the Ministry to stop all contract processes contained in 2024, until the issue of the alleged diverted money is resolved.
The committee also asked the minister to come before it with details of the special account allegedly opened for the Chibok girls as well as the memorandum of understanding signed with the American University of Nigeria for the training of the girls.
The committee chairman alleged that the Ministry initiated new contracts not captured in the 2023 budget and diverted the N1.5bn into those contracts instead of using the money to pay old contractors.
Hon. Kafilat Ogbara said the Ministry awarded fresh contracts in 15 states of the federation, similarly not captured in the 2023 appropriation while owing contractors.
“Money for contractors has not been paid and money released has been diverted. So how do you pay these contractors”, she asked.
She disclosed that there is an ongoing probe of the Ministry by the Independent Corrupt Practices Commission (ICPC) on overhead release of November/December 2023 to the tune of N1.5bn.
She said the ministry signed a memorandum of understanding MoU with the American University of Nigeria, Yola for the payment of Chibok girls’ school fees for seven years.
The committee is probing the N1.5 billion allegedly meant for the payment of contractors but allegedly diverted by officials of the Ministry.
Responding to some of the allegations, the Permanent Secretary in the ministry, Amb. Gabriel Aduda explained that in 2023, the ministry’s total budget was N13.6 billion with N3.4 billion, translating to 25 percent, while the unreleased balance stood at N10.2 billion”.
Director of Finance of the Ministry, Aloy Ifeakandu said he only complies with official directives from his superiors. He added that the records are available.
He said: “I resumed the ministry in September 2023, I wouldn’t know what happened before I came. The individual contractors have their files, it can be traced, as at the time I took over, there was no balance in the vote.”

Labour Party’s Triumph In UK, Sign That LP Will Win Nigeria’s 2027 Election – Rep
![](https://spazr.com.ng/wp-content/uploads/2024/07/Labour-Partys-Triumph-In-UK-Sign-That-LP-Will-Win.jpg)
Afam Victor Ogene, the Leader of the Labour Party Caucus of the House of Representatives, has said the victory of opposition Labour Party in the United Kingdom, UK, is a sign that its Nigerian version would triumph in the 2027 general elections.
In a statement made available to journalists in Awka, Friday, Ogene said the election told vivid tales of hope for the opposition, and competence and integrity of the electoral umpires in the UK, in a manner that elicits public confidence and trust in the electoral process.
“Unlike what was witnessed in Nigeria in the last general elections, the process in UK was free of glitches, as about 40 million voters took part. Polls closed around 10 pm Thursday and by daybreak, the results were out.
“There was no judicial ambush, as immediate transition took place to the admiration of all lovers of democracy and free and fair elections.
“If we must practice democracy, we must also love, copy and abide by the transparency and accountability of democratic institutions in nations of the world that allow the rule of law and democratic principles to thrive.
“In deed, one of the potent lessons of the British elections is the fact that, the concept of ‘snatch it, grab it, and run away with it,’ has no place in modern democratic practice,” he said.
Relating the development in the UK to the 2027 election in Nigeria, Ogene said: “I urge the Nigerian Labour Party to draw inspiration from its British counterparts, close ranks, rally the people, and prepare to take the reins of power in 2027.
“Let us work together to build a better future for our nation, guided by the principles of democracy, transparency, and accountability.”
Ogene congratulated Keir Starmer, the leader of the Labour Party in Britain, for his party’s victory over the outgoing UK Prime Minister, Rishi Sunak and his Conservative Party, in what has been described as the most emphatic election victory by any British political party this century.
The opposition Labour Party won a huge parliamentary majority in the UK general election, unseating the incumbent Conservatives after 14 years.
While the Labour Party got 412 seats, the incumbent Conservatives got just 121.

Kenya President, William Ruto Removes Budgets For Offices Of First Lady, Second Lady After Anti-Government Protects
![](https://spazr.com.ng/wp-content/uploads/2024/07/Kenya-President-William-Ruto-Removes-Budgets-For-Offices-Of-First.jpg)
William Ruto, the President of Kenya, has announced the country’s National Treasury will cut spending to make room for key commitments after anti-government protests.
In a live address from the state house, Ruto said the government will present a proposal to the national assembly to approve massive expenditure cuts after the withdrawal of the 2024 finance bill.
“Over the last few days, our treasury team has been assessing the adverse impact of either reducing the budget by the entire Sh346 billion or borrowing the full amount,” he stated on Friday.
“We have since struck a middle ground and will be proposing to the National Assembly a budget cut of Sh177 billion and borrow the difference. The additional borrowing will increase our fiscal deficit from 3.3 per cent to 4.6 per cent and will be used to protect the funding of critical government services,” President Ruto stated.
President Ruto listed several critical government initiatives that will receive continued funding, including the hiring of medical interns, support for dairy farmers, road infrastructure projects, fertilizer subsidies, and settlements of debts owed to farmers in various sectors.
In addition to the financial adjustments, President Ruto also removed budgets for the offices of the first lady, and the second lady.
Dissolution of 47 State Corporations to eliminate overlapping functions and reduce operational costs.
Suspension of filling Chief Administrative Secretaries positions.
50 per cent reduction in government advisors within the public service.
Removal of budget lines for offices of First Lady, spouses of Deputy President, and Prime Cabinet Secretary.
Suspension of non-essential travel and participation in public contributions by state and public officers.
“These measures are part of our commitment to enhance efficiency and transparency in serving the people of Kenya,” President Ruto affirmed.
“We are determined to improve the quality of services and ensure maximum value for the resources entrusted to us.”

How A 30-Year-Old Man Allegedly R*ped A 12-Year-Old Girl In Ekiti
![](https://spazr.com.ng/wp-content/uploads/2024/07/How-A-30-Year-Old-Man-Allegedly-Rped-A-12-Year-Old-Girl-In.jpg)
Olaniyi Sunday, a 30-year-old man, has been jailed in Ekiti.
He was remanded on Friday in a correctional centre on the order of an Ado-Ekiti Chief Magistrates’ Court for allegedly r*ping a minor.
The defendant, whose address was not provided, is facing a lone charge of alleged r*pe.
The police prosecutor, Insp Sodiq Adeniyi, told the court that the defendant allegedly committed the offence of r*ping a 12-year-old girl between April and June at Araromi in Omuo-Ekiti.
Adeniyi said the defendant, a neighbour to the victim, saw her stealing meat in another neighbour’s pot and threatened to expose her but on the condition that he had sex with her.
He said the victim did not accept the condition until she was r*ped in the process.
The prosecutor urged the court to remand the defendant pending the issuance of legal advice from the Office of the Director of Public Prosecution (DPP).
The plea of the defendant was, however, not taken.
Chief Magistrate Dolamu Babalogbon ordered the remand of the defendant in the correctional centre, pending the release of the legal advice.
She, subsequently, adjourned the case till Aug. 7 for mention.
